Can I post portrait images on Twitter?
In-stream images are displayed at a 16:9 ratio of 600px by 335px and can be clicked and expanded up to 1200px by 675px. This means is that you can upload any shape photo, be it square, vertical, or horizontal. It will just be cropped in a 600px by 335px preview in-stream and display in full once clicked on.

What image format is best for Twitter?
Twitter images sizes for in-stream photos: 1600 x 900 pixels (recommended)
- Minimum size: 600 by 335 pixels.
- Recommended aspect ratio: any aspect between 2:1 and 1:1 on desktop; 2:1, 3:4 and 16:9 on mobile.
- Supported formats: GIF, JPG and PNG.
- Maximum file size: Up to 5MB for photos and GIFs on mobile.

What size are Twitter photos?
The ideal image size and aspect ratio are 1200px X 675px and 16:9, respectively. The maximum file size is 5MB for photos and animated GIFs. You can go up to 15MB if you're posting via their website. You can tweet up to four images per post.

What aspect ratio is Twitter?
16:9First things first: 2:1 is no longer the correct image aspect ratio for your Twitter news feed. The right aspect ratio is now 16:9. The minimum size is600 pixels wide x 335 pixels tall. For larger images, the ideal image size is 1200 pixels wide x 675 pixels tall.

What does 3 pictures on Twitter look like?
For 3 images, one image will display as 7:8 ratio with the other pair stacked in 4:7 ratios. With 4 images, each thumbnail will display in 2:1 ratio in a grid. Individual images have a height of 600-1200 px and width of 1200 px for an aspect ratio of Ratio will be cropped by image arrangement.

How do you rotate twitter on iPhone?
Check Rotation Lock On an iPhone with a Home button, swipe up from the bottom of the screen to access it. On an iPhone without a Home button, swipe down from the top-right corner of the screen instead. Here, tap on the rotation lock icon (which looks like a lock with a circular arrow) to turn it on or off.
